Here’s what we discussed:

In the face of ever-evolving fraud schemes, product owners, leaders, and innovators grapple with how to create a safe and seamless user experience while managing risk. The fundamental question, “How do we balance risk and ensure an exceptional customer experience?” is one all business leaders must now ask themselves—and the answer will vary depending on your specific use case and customer.

Identity authentication and verification throughout the customer lifecycle is now commonly accepted as a must-have, but the path to implementing it without creating more user friction is less clear.
Justo Hernández, Solutions Engineer at Telesign, joined this interactive roundtable event which explored the most urgent topics in fraud prevention today, including how to:
  1. Prepare for emerging and prominent fraud schemes: what they are and how they impact your organization. Walk away with prevention strategies for International Revenue Share Fraud (IRSF), synthetic identity fraud, account takeovers, fake users, bots, and more.
  2. Understand multi-factor authentication (MFA): strengths, shortcomings, and opportunities with today’s most popular security frameworks.
  3. Define the right balance between security and a seamless user experience with scalable methodologies to distinguish safe users from fake users.
